Understanding Small Business Health Insurance Options in Texas

Small businesses in Texas have several options when it comes to providing health insurance to their employees. One popular option is group health insurance, which allows businesses to purchase coverage for their employees as a group. This type of plan typically offers lower rates than individual plans and may provide more comprehensive coverage. Another option is self-funded health insurance, where the business sets aside funds to pay for employee medical expenses. This type of plan can be more cost-effective for businesses with healthier employees.

Requirements for Small Business Health Insurance in Texas

In Texas, small businesses with fewer than 50 employees are not required by law to offer health insurance. However, businesses with more than 50 employees may face penalties if they do not provide health insurance that meets certain requirements under the Affordable Care Act (ACA). These requirements include offering coverage that meets minimum essential coverage standards and affordability requirements.

Texas Small Business Health Insurance Laws and Regulations

Texas has several laws and regulations that govern small business health insurance, including the ACA and state-specific regulations. Businesses with more than 50 employees must comply with the ACA's employer mandate, which requires them to offer health insurance that meets certain standards. Additionally, Texas law requires insurance providers to cover certain essential health benefits, such as preventive care, maternity care, and mental health services.

Alternatives to Traditional Health Insurance for Small Businesses in Texas

In addition to traditional health insurance plans, there are several alternative options available to small businesses in Texas. One popular option is a health savings account (HSA), which allows employees to set aside pre-tax funds to pay for medical expenses. Another option is a health reimbursement arrangement (HRA), which reimburses employees for medical expenses. These alternatives can provide more flexibility and cost savings for both employers and employees.
